For anyone who is unfamiliar, a throwdown is a friendly competition between forum members. We will decide on a category. There will be a deadline set, and you are allowed to enter one (1) entry. A winner will be chosen by the forum membership, and, occasionally, we have prizes to award.

More details will be given in the announcement post, but that is the gist of it.
